Hazel Findlay
Hazel Findlay is a British traditional climber, sport climber and big wall climber. She was the first female British climber to climb a route graded E9, and a route graded. She did the third ascent of the Yosemite traditional route Magic Line. She has free climbed El Capitán four times on four different routes and made many first female ascents on other routes. Biography
Findlay was born in 1989, the daughter of climber Steve Findlay.She began climbing on the sea cliffs of Pembrokeshire with her father when she was six years old.
She became a six-time junior national rock climbing champion but gave up competition climbing in favor of traditional climbing.
She is a graduate of the University of Bristol, where she studied philosophy.
She lives in North Wales. She married climber Angus Kille in Las Vegas in 2023.
Notable climbs
In 2019, Findlay made the 3rd ascent of Magic Line, a route graded 5.14b/c at Vernal Fall in Yosemite National Park. She made the first female ascent of a British E9 grade climb with her June 2011 climb of Dave Birkett's route Once Upon a Time in the South West at Dyer's Lookout in Devon.She is the first British woman to free climb El Capitán in Yosemite National Park, which she has done four times: she made the first female ascent of Golden Gate in 2011, the first female ascent of Pre-Muir Wall in 2012, and an ascent of Freerider in only three days in 2013. In 2017 she free-climbed the Salathé Wall.
She was the first person to free-climb Adder Crack, in Squamish, British Columbia, in 2012. She was the first person to climb 'Tainted Love' in Squamish.
With Jack Geldard, she made the first ascent of the front face of the Aiguille de Saussure, a spire in the Mont Blanc massif, Chamonix, France, also in 2012. In 2022, along with Alex Honnold, she made a first free ascent of Ingmikortilaq, a 3,750-foot wall and one of the world’s tallest monoliths, in Greenland. Other first female ascents of trad routes by Findlay include:
- Air Sweden in Indian Creek, Utah, in April 2010.
- 69 in Squamish, later in 2010.
- San Simeon in Pembrokeshire, in May 2011.The Doors in Cadarese, Italy, in 2012.
- Chicama in Anglesey, in early 2013.
- First ascent of Tainted Love in Squamish, in April 2018.
- Magic Line in Yosemite, on 26 November 2019.
- Mission Impossible on Gallt yr Ogof, Wales, on 22 September 2020.
- In 2014, she climbed Fish Eye in Oliana, Spain, reaching a difficulty level of 8c/5.14b. Although not a first female ascent it was the highest level attained by a British female climber.
- In 2017, she climbed Mind Control, also in Oliana.
- In 2022, she climbed Esclatamasters in Catalonia, Spain.
